qt中listwidget的一些使用

最近因为项目需要,做一个基于串口通信的一个上位机。
要获取listwidget中item的当前编号,
connect(ui->listWidget,SIGNAL(itemDoubleClicked(QListWidgetItem)),this,SLOT(List1_singleclicked(QListWidgetItem)));
connect(ui->listWidget,SIGNAL(itemClicked(QListWidgetItem*)),this,SLOT(List1_singleclicked(QListWidgetItem*)))**;
先写相对应item的连接函数,再在槽函数中获取行号即可
void MainWindow::List1_singleclicked(QListWidgetItem* item)
{

int j = ui->listWidget->currentRow();

qDebug()<<“j=”<<j;
}

在这里插入图片描述

发布了29 篇原创文章 · 获赞 8 · 访问量 1万+

猜你喜欢

转载自blog.csdn.net/weixin_42542969/article/details/88240451